About Paysera Payment Card EUR
For most Paysera users the account lives in euros — it's a Lithuanian e-money service with a European IBAN, so euro is its home currency. This Paysera payment card tops it up in exactly that. It's a prepaid Rewarble voucher denominated in EUR: you redeem the code on Rewarble, and the value becomes a payment method you can use to fund your Paysera balance. Consequently, euros reach the account without a SEPA transfer from your bank, and without a bank card of yours anywhere in the process.
Since the voucher is already in euros, there's nothing to convert. Therefore, the amount you buy is the amount that arrives, with no margin taken on the way.

How to Redeem Your Paysera Payment Card EUR
- Go to rewarble.com and sign in, or register a new account.
- Select the option to redeem a voucher.
- Enter your code exactly as issued.
- Confirm, and Rewarble credits the euro value to your account.
